Does Ted have a public speaking course?

Master a variety of communication skills with TED’s official public speaking course, now available on YouTube Courses. This course will teach you how to identify, develop and share your best ideas with the world. YouTube Courses are currently only available in the United States, but YouTube is working on expanding into other regions in 2023.

What is included in a TED study?

On TED.com, each TED Study includes a curated video collection, as well as an introductory essay and summary analysis. An expanded version of TED Studies — including special modules on each talk with questions, assignments, key terms and recommended reading — is available by license for academic settings.
